What is G Data Total Security?

G Data Total Security is a comprehensive cybersecurity suite developed by G Data Software AG, a German company that holds the distinction of creating the world’s first antivirus software in 1987. Founded in Bochum, Germany, G Data has been protecting users from digital threats for over 35 years, establishing itself as a pioneer in the cybersecurity industry. The company’s German engineering heritage emphasizes thoroughness, reliability, and meticulous attention to security details that have become hallmarks of its products.

What distinguishes G Data from competitors is its dual-engine scanning technology, which combines two independent antivirus engines to provide multiple layers of malware detection. This approach, called DoubleScan, uses both G Data’s own detection engine and a licensed engine from Bitdefender, dramatically reducing the chances of threats slipping through. This dual-engine strategy consistently achieves near-perfect detection rates in independent testing, making G Data one of the most effective antivirus solutions available.

G Data serves users across consumer and business markets, with particular strength in German-speaking countries and throughout Europe. The company maintains strict data protection standards compliant with European GDPR regulations and German privacy laws, making it an attractive choice for privacy-conscious users. With a comprehensive feature set including firewall, parental controls, backup, encryption, and more, G Data Total Security provides complete digital protection for individuals and families seeking German-engineered security excellence.

Key Features

  • DoubleScan Technology: Utilizes two independent antivirus engines simultaneously for superior malware detection, significantly reducing the possibility of threats evading detection.
  • Anti-Ransomware: Behavioral monitoring specifically designed to detect and stop ransomware attacks before files can be encrypted, with rollback capabilities for affected files.
  • BankGuard: Specialized banking protection that secures online transactions by preventing manipulation of browser processes and protecting against banking trojans.
  • Personal Firewall: Intelligent two-way firewall that monitors incoming and outgoing network traffic, automatically configuring rules while allowing advanced manual control.
  • Anti-Spam: Advanced email filtering that blocks spam and phishing emails before they reach your inbox, working with all major email clients.
  • Parental Controls: Comprehensive content filtering and time management tools to protect children online with customizable profiles for different age groups.
  • Backup Module: Integrated backup solution for automatic protection of important files to local drives, network locations, or cloud storage services.
  • Password Manager: Secure storage and management of passwords and credentials with AES-256 encryption and automatic form filling capabilities.
  • Device Control: Monitor and restrict use of USB drives and other external devices to prevent data theft and malware infection from removable media.
  • Performance Tuner: System optimization tools that clean unnecessary files, manage startup programs, and improve overall computer performance.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is DoubleScan and why does it matter?

DoubleScan is G Data’s signature technology that uses two independent antivirus engines simultaneously to scan for threats. One engine is G Data’s proprietary technology, while the other is licensed from Bitdefender. This dual approach significantly increases detection rates because if one engine misses a threat, the other is likely to catch it. Independent tests consistently show this results in near-perfect malware detection with very low false positives, making DoubleScan one of the most effective detection methods available.

How does BankGuard protect online banking?

BankGuard is a specialized technology designed to protect online banking and financial transactions. It works by creating a protected memory space for your browser when you visit banking websites, preventing other software from intercepting or manipulating the connection. This stops banking trojans from capturing login credentials or modifying transactions. BankGuard activates automatically when it detects you’re visiting a financial website, requiring no user intervention while providing an extra layer of security.
